Roxbury was not able to break out of their rough patch on Saturday as the team picked up their fourth straight defeat. They took a 6-1 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Immaculate Heart Academy Blue Eagles.
For Immaculate Heart Academy's part, Gabi Dellavolpe sp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ered only one earned run on seven hits and racked up six Ks. Dellavolpe has been nothing but reliable: she hasn't given up more than two walks in six consecutive pitching appearances.
At the plate, Gianna Dimeglio was excellent, scoring a run while going 3-for-4.
Roxbury's loss dropped their record down to 2-5. As for Immaculate Heart Academy, the victory (which was their eighth in a row) raised their record to 12-1.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Roxbury will square off against Sparta at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Sparta's pitching crew has only allowed 3.2 runs per game this season, so Roxbury's hitters will have their work cut out for them. As for Immaculate Heart Academy, they will head out on the road to face off against Academy of the Holy A at 4:15 p.m. on Monday.
